From 010e253d66fb6faef5596eb06461a8ccadf36f51 Mon Sep 17 00:00:00 2001 From: claude Date: Sun, 26 Jul 2026 02:22:35 +0000 Subject: [PATCH] docs: sharpen the attribution guarantee to a byte<->activation-key binding M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it Revised per PR #480 (#5607 owner clarification + #5608 codex resolution; #5612 directs the update): - The audit row no longer implies upstream observation or agent-only authorship. Reworded the guarantee: the row cryptographically binds commit bytes (control-plane-RECOMPUTED SHA) to access to the activation signing key, and binds that key to control-plane-owned activation metadata. An agent can sign arbitrary contents but cannot verify as a different activation or choose the recorded metadata. - Control plane accepts gateway-delivered opaque bytes, independently recomputes the Git object ID, verifies the embedded signature against the activation key, and stamps its own metadata. Trusts no gateway SHA/key/verdict/metadata. No upstream fetch. - Purged overclaims: removed "a compromised gateway cannot fabricate an audit binding" (the sidecar holds the signing capability, so it can — and that's acceptable under the intended guarantee), plus "accepted push" / "introduced upstream" framing. - Resolved the control-plane-transport open question in-PRD (was left open; codex asked to resolve): transport is gateway bytes + recompute + verify; mirror-read is no stronger.
